Output 59a8eac1057f45fae90351ab80cf47dc4a5b3f9829596155023b4472b309f1f1:0

value
104529047
script pubkey
OP_0 OP_PUSHBYTES_20 8ddbda7b72881b0e36e0c019d1440af9a9b09dbe
address
bc1q3hda57mj3qdsudhqcqvaz3q2lx5mp8d7sws7v3
transaction
59a8eac1057f45fae90351ab80cf47dc4a5b3f9829596155023b4472b309f1f1
spent
true